Hvac Replacement in Monmouth County, NJ
HVAC replacement services involve removing an outdated or malfunctioning heating, ventilation, and air conditioning system and installing a new unit to ensure reliable climate control within a property. These projects typically cover the full replacement of furnaces, air conditioners, heat pumps, or ductless systems, often necessary when existing equipment is no longer efficient, has failed, or no longer meets the heating and cooling needs of the home. Property owners usually want to understand the compatibility of new systems with their property, the benefits of modern energy-efficient models, and what to expect during the installation process to ensure a smooth transition.
Before requesting HVAC replacement services, homeowners should consider the size of their property, preferred energy efficiency levels, and any specific features they desire in a new system. It’s also helpful to evaluate the age and condition of existing equipment, as well as any potential upgrades to ductwork or ventilation that may be needed. Understanding these factors can help property owners make informed decisions about the type and capacity of new HVAC equipment that will best serve their comfort needs and long-term savings.

Hvac Replacement Questions
When is HVAC replacement necessary? Replacement is typically needed when an existing system becomes inefficient, unreliable, or requires frequent repairs that outweigh the cost of a new unit.
What types of HVAC systems can be replaced? Common replacement options include central air conditioners, furnaces, heat pumps, and ductless mini-split systems.
How can property owners prepare for an HVAC replacement? Clearing space around the existing unit and providing access for installation can help ensure a smooth replacement process.
What factors influence the choice of a new HVAC system? Considerations include property size, existing ductwork, and energy efficiency preferences to select the most suitable system.
